A1GP - Sepang qualifying results update
Following Stewards’ enquiries, it has been decided to disallow A1 Team Germany’s time in Qualifying session one. After studying video footage, the Stewards found Nico Hülkenberg had caused an avoidable collision with A1 Team Ireland’s Michael Devaney. Hülkenberg however retains third position on the Sprint race grid despite the penalty. Read More >>

Media statement- A1GP Beijing China
Today’s two practice sessions for the A1GP Beijing, China have been cancelled to allow organisers to address issues with the brand new street circuit. While the track, designed especially for the A1GP World Cup of Motorsport Series received its FIA Grade 2 approval this morning as planned, organisers have opted to delay on-track activity until their concerns over one section of the track have been addressed. A1GP Very Important People
Beijing, the setting for this weekend’s A1GP World Cup of Motorsport race, will host the 2008 Olympic Games next summer in a spectacular new stadium christened the Bird’s Nest due to its distinctive ‘hatched’ construction, and a swimming complex nicknamed the Watercube. Today A1GP drivers had a truly VIP opportunity to see the Watercube up close when they were given a tour of the building. The access is usually reserved for members of state and visiting dignitaries – so the boys were on their best behaviour throughout!
